1960 Holden FC vs. 1945 Skoda Polular 995
To start off, 1960 Holden FC is newer by 15 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1945 Skoda Polular 995.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1945 Skoda Polular 995 would be higher. At 2,165 cc (6 cylinders), 1960 Holden FC is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1960 Holden FC (62 HP @ 4000 RPM) has 40 more horse power than 1945 Skoda Polular 995. (22 HP @ 3500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1960 Holden FC should accelerate faster than 1945 Skoda Polular 995.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1960 Holden FC weights approximately 250 kg more than 1945 Skoda Polular 995.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Compare all specifications:
1960 Holden FC | 1945 Skoda Polular 995 | |
Make | Holden | Skoda |
Model | FC | Polular 995 |
Year Released | 1960 | 1945 |
Engine Size | 2165 cc | 995 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 2 valves | 2 valves |
Horse Power | 62 HP | 22 HP |
Engine RPM | 4000 RPM | 3500 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Vehicle Weight | 980 kg | 730 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4480 mm | 3810 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1710 mm | 1410 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1560 mm | 1490 mm |
